ABSTRACT
Proposed and demonstrated is a novel scheme of a dual-channel-output all-optical logic AND gate. Using cascaded sum- and difference-frequency generation in a periodically poled lithium niobate (PPLN) waveguide, 20 Gbit/s logic AND operation with dual-channel outputs is successfully observed in the experiment.
